Edward Harry Deezen is an American actor and comedian. A native of Cumberland, Maryland, he initially began his career as a stand-up comedian before moving to California, where he would quickly become known for his roles as "nerd" characters in films including the Grease movies, Midnight Madness (1980), I Wanna Hold Your Hand (1978), and WarGames (1983). He is also known for his various voice acting roles across multiple movies and TV series, most notably as Mandark in Dexter's Laboratory (1996), the Know-It-All Kid in The Polar Express (2004), and Ned in Kim Possible (2002).- Producer

Rebeca Arthur was born and grew up in a small town in western Maryland. Her father was a salesman who died when she was a baby and her mother was a homemaker. She began dancing lessons at the age of four and knew at an early age that she would pursue a career in show business. She left her small town to attend the University of Maryland at College Park. After 3 semesters, she transferred to an an acting academy in New York City but left there after a year and then finished her education at New York University. While in school in NY, she worked for a private investigator for 3 years before quitting after graduation to pursue acting full-time. Along with theater appearances in various off off Broadway theatre productions, she started appearing sporadically on soap operas in New York. She acquired her SAG card when she was cast in a toilet paper commercial. Her comedic turns on soap operas caught the attention of her agents and she was talked into going to Los Angeles for pilot season. She was cast in the very first thing she auditioned for in LA which was a sitcom pilot starring Vicki Lawrence and Lauren Tewes. Called Anything For Love. She continued to work in television and film for that first year in LA before auditioning for a guest star role in a new sitcom called Perfect Strangers. Cast as Mary Anne for one episode for one week, she found herself returning for the rest of the shows run which spanned 8 seasons. Other notable film credits include, About Last Night, Scrooged, A Dangerous Woman, Get Shorty, Men Seeking Women, Every Breathe.- Actor

Daniel Sollinger is a graduate of New York University's Film School, and the producer of more than 400 commercials, music videos, and short films for clients including Pepsi, Warner Brothers Records, CBS, Sony, and Comedy Central. His work has won awards from New York University, The American Film Institute, The Accolade Awards and the American Motion Picture Society. His work has played at SXSW, Tribeca, Toronto, Berlin, and many other film festivals, and can be seen on multiple streaming platforms throughout the world.
After working on numerous rap videos for artists such as Will Smith, and A Tribe Called Quest, Daniel produced "Rhyme & Reason," a feature film documentary on hip-hop culture, which has been named by Rolling Stone Magazine as one of the top 35 music documentaries of all time.
Since then, Daniel has gone on to produce or line produce over 60 independent feature films, including "Clean", "The Alphabet Killer," "Girls Against Boys," "In My Sleep," and "Without Men."
He also directed the feature documentary, "Immortality or Bust" and is in production on another called, "AgeLess"
He is a member of the PGA and a DGA Unit Production Manager.- Director

Bryan Norton has an M.F.A. degree in Film Production from New York University's Tisch School of The Arts Graduate Film Program, and a B.A. in Cinema Studies from Sarah Lawrence College. He wrote and directed the award winning horror film Penny Dreadful with a generous grant from Warner Bros, starring Friday the 13th's Betsy Palmer and has won over one hundred film festival awards worldwide. As a professor and lecturer of film, Bryan has taught film directing and screenwriting throughout the United States since 2001 and served as the chairperson of The New York Film Academy. He also has consulted on several documentaries, books and articles relating to the history and analysis of the horror genre, including Butcher Knives and Body Counts: Essays of the Formula, Frights and Fun of the Shalsher Film, Going To Pieces: The Rise and Fall of the Slasher Film , Corman's World: Exploits of a Hollywood Rebel and Fangoria Magazine.
